Definitions:

Control Charts

Tools used in quality control to monitor, control, and improve process performance over time by charting the values of a statistical measure and comparing them to predetermined limits.

P Chart

A type of control chart used for monitoring the proportion of defective items in a process over time.

Control Charts

Graphical tools used to determine if a manufacturing or business process is in a state of statistical control.

Sample Proportion

The ratio or fraction of sample observations that belong to a certain category or that exhibit a particular attribute or characteristic.
